## Break-Glass Access — CSV Import Wizard

New to the Fernbrook team? Read this before touching ImportHawk.

If the CSV import wizard locks mid-batch and the admin console is unreachable, use break-glass access. Do not retry the batch first — it corrupts the staging table. Open the ops terminal, run the unlock routine, and log the incident in the Fernbrook tracker within one hour. Break-glass use is audited weekly.

The unlock routine will prompt for the recovery passphrase, which is:

unlock words, yadup-bafog: belwyn-gorwyn-norok-novwyn-goriel-ulaox-framir-queneth-oliion

**Memo — Reseller Programme Overview**

Welcome aboard! Quick primer on the Kestrel Partner Programme before your first review. We have three tiers — Bronze through Gold — with margin steps at each level. Around forty active resellers, mostly in the Velmark region; Gold partners drive two-thirds of channel revenue. Renewals land in Q3, so timing matters. The plans we're weighing for the programme are noted below.

board note of baweg-bawig: Project Tamath slips by six weeks because of the audit delay.

### Ticket: Docs Linter Rule Update — Sign-off Needed

The Pinewharf documentation linter now flags embedded credentials patterns and unsanctioned external links in markdown sources. Security review is required because the new rules read file contents from private repos during CI. No content leaves the build environment; findings stay in the job log. Please review the rule set and data handling, then record sign-off from the responsible engineer.

named custodian: Brivan Eliath Quenox Frador